CII to take up environment restoration project at Marudhamalai temple

| Photo Credit: M. PeriasamyConfederation of Indian Industry, Coimbatore Zone, will take up eco-restoration project at Marudhamalai. Mukund G Rajan, Chairman, Tata Global Sustainability Council, Chief Ethics Officer, Tata Sons Ltd., speaking at the annual day of the Confederation of Indian Industry- Coimbatore Zone in Coimbatore on Saturday. Outgoing chairperson of the CII - Coimbatore Nethra Kumar told reporters here on Saturday that a detailed study has been done and talks are on with the local panchayat, the HR & CE Department, Forest Department, and the temple Devasthanam. A detailed analysis has been done and the entire project is expected to be little more than ? 50 lakh. Chairperson of CII-Coimbatore Nethra JS Kumar (second right) is in the picture.
